The Canon Rebel SL3, also known as the EOS 250D in some markets, is a popular entry-level DSLR known for its compact size and excellent image quality. One of its standout features is its color rendition, which varies beautifully across different environments.
Overview of the Canon Rebel SL3
The SL3 boasts a 24.1-megapixel APS-C sensor, DIGIC 8 image processor, and a vari-angle touchscreen. Its user-friendly interface makes it ideal for beginners, while its color accuracy and dynamic range appeal to more experienced photographers.
Color Rendition in Natural Light
In outdoor settings with abundant natural light, the SL3 captures vibrant colors with excellent accuracy. Skin tones appear natural, and foliage greens are rich without being oversaturated. The camera handles high-contrast scenes well, maintaining detail in both shadows and highlights.
Sunlit Landscapes
Photos taken during midday sun reveal the camera’s ability to produce bright, lively colors. The blue sky and green grass stand out vividly, showcasing the camera’s dynamic range.
Shade and Overcast Conditions
In shaded areas or on overcast days, the SL3 maintains warm, pleasing tones. Colors are soft yet well-defined, and the camera’s automatic white balance adapts effectively to different lighting conditions.
Color Performance Indoors
Inside buildings, the SL3’s color rendition depends heavily on lighting. Under warm incandescent lights, it tends to produce a slightly yellowish tint, which can be corrected in post-processing. Under daylight-balanced LED lights, colors appear accurate and natural.
Portrait Photography
Portraits benefit from the camera’s ability to render skin tones smoothly. The SL3 captures subtle variations in skin color, resulting in flattering images with natural warmth.
Product and Food Photography
Colors in close-up shots of products and food are rendered accurately, with vibrant reds, greens, and other hues. Proper white balance settings enhance the true-to-life color presentation.
Color in Low-Light Environments
In low-light situations, the SL3’s ISO performance influences color accuracy. At higher ISO settings, colors may shift slightly, often towards warmer tones. Using a tripod and proper white balance can help preserve true colors.
Night Photography
Night scenes captured with the SL3 show good color fidelity, especially with long exposures. Streetlights and neon signs introduce vibrant, saturated colors that the camera reproduces well, adding to the atmospheric quality of night shots.
